Transaction e2105ad587761faaa2ed747eccc16aeedc424e52005781d297927db5e87d6c92
1 Input
1 Output
-
e2105ad587761faaa2ed747eccc16aeedc424e52005781d297927db5e87d6c92:0
- value
- 362768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d98d865d4fd6bfd9d5b8c0358d84abc142a22b5c OP_EQUAL
- address
- 3MXL6VQzy34bmVD8guHd62SQ4XGGFSqwmZ